Women's Soccer Team To Host Dayton

Virginia Tech women's soccer squad will host a first-round NCAA match in Blacksburg this weekend.

Monday afternoon the Hokies were selected to the NCAA tournament for the seventh-consecutive time. With a 14-5 record on the year Virginia Tech drew a home matchup against the Dayton Flyers who recently won the Atlantic-10 and finished the year with a 12-8-2 record.

Virginia Tech was become a nationally renowned women's soccer program as they made it to the Final Four last season and look to advance deep in this year's tournament. The hard working, blue-collar style of play that coach Chugger Adair has instilled in this program starts every year at the end of the summer when they lay out their team goals, one of which was to get back to this tournament.

The match against Dayton will be Saturday, November 15 at 7pm at Thompson Field in Blacksburg. Tickets can be on HokieSports.com.
